San Jose Sharks at Detroit Red Wings odds, picks and prediction

The San Jose Sharks are coming off an 8-5 loss at the Pittsburgh Penguins Sunday. The Sharks have scored 16 goals in three games since returning from the holiday break and allowed 17 goals. Detroit dropped a 5-1 home game to the Boston Bruins Sunday and is winless in two games after a 13-day break.

James Reimer and Alex Nedeljkovic are the projected goalies for the Sharks and Red Wings. Reiner was pulled in Pittsburgh after giving up 6 goals on 17 shots in the first period. Nedelski allowed 5 goals against Boston Bruins on Sunday.

The Red Wings are 7-3 in their last 10 games at home and have won six of the last eight games in this series. The Sharks are a team that has forgotten how to play defensively. Over 5.5 is the best play in the game.
